Gandaki CM Adhikari seeking vote of confidence today
Gandaki Province Chief Minister Khagaraj Adhikari is seeking a vote of confidence today.
According to the Gandaki Province Assembly (PA) Secretariat, the Chief Minister is scheduled to seek a vote of confidence at 3 pm today.
He was elected to the post on April 7 with the support of the CPN-UML, CPN (Maoist Center), and one independent PA member.
As per the Constitution, the Chief Minister is mandated to obtain a vote of confidence from the PA no later than thirty days after the date of the appointment.
